在C語言中,可以使用exit函數來直接退出程序。exit函數位于stdlib.h頭文件中,其原型如下:
void exit(int status);
其中,status參數是退出狀態碼,可以在程序退出時返回給操作系統。通常情況下,可以使用0表示程序正常退出,非零值表示異常退出。
以下是一個示例代碼,演示如何使用exit函數直接退出程序:
#include <stdlib.h> #include <stdio.h>
int main() { printf(“程序開始執行\n”);
// 執行一些代碼
printf("程序即將退出\n");
exit(0); // 退出程序,并返回狀態碼0
// 以下代碼不會被執行
printf("這行代碼不會被執行\n");
return 0;
}
在上述代碼中,程序在執行到exit函數時會直接退出,后續的代碼不會被執行。程序正常退出時,狀態碼為0。